TxDOT's Austin District has a job opening for an
IT & Transportation Technology Systems Program Manager at the
Austin District Headquarters located in
Austin, Texas. This position oversees and manages multiple Intelligent Transportation Systems (ITS) and transportation technology management projects. Develops and revises new and existing ITS and transportation technology systems. Procure and administer ITS and transportation technology management system projects and contracts. Coordinate vendor, consultants, teams, resources, and stakeholders to accomplish project and district goals and objectives. Performs highly responsible technical work including the analysis, design and implementation of automated traffic management systems including emerging technology. Serve the district as technical expert on new and existing ITS and transportation technology management systems. May be responsible for administering information resources and telecommunication hardware/software located within a Intelligent Transportation Operations Center. Work requires contact with governmental and private entities. Employees at this level establish their own work plan and priorities to meet set objectives. Issues are rarely referred to the supervisor but are handled at the occurrences.

Position Description
This position develops and revises new and existing intelligent transportation system(s) (ITS). Performs highly responsible technical work including the analysis, design and implementation of automated traffic management systems. May be responsible for administering information resources and telecommunication hardware/software located within an Intelligent Transportation Operations Center. Work requires contact with governmental and private entities. Employees at this level establish their own work plan and priorities to meet set objectives. Issues are rarely referred to the supervisor but are handled at the occurrence.


Essential Duties:


  • May serve as project leader.
  • Analyzes, researches and recommends hardware and software needs. including assessing resources utilization and justification
  • Coordinates project schedule for the installation, Implementation and upgrade of systems.
  • Develops ITS which includes writing design documentation and methods, preparing work diagrams and data flow charts, evaluating systems hardware and hardware, analyzing user requirements, testing software and performing field tests.
  • Keeps abreast of new technology to improve current and projected systems.
  • Prepares and monitors budget.
  • Provides technical direction in the analysis and design of ITS.
  • Researches. evaluates and recommends vendor supplied software and hardware.
  • Reviews traffic management plans and inspects project sites to ensure compliance with system requirements.
  • Writes or revises specifications, amendments, and contract provisions related. to ITS.
